This is a very nice example of the Savage Navy Model, a six shot . 36 caliber revolver, was made from 1861 until 1862 with a total production of only 20,000 guns. This unique military revolver was one of the few handguns that was produced only for Civil War use. Its design was based on the antebellum Savage North "figure eight" revolver.
